A propeller engine (1) which is configured for providing thrust for an aircraft (100), in particular an aircraft (100) having vertical takeoff and landing capability, comprises a bearing structure (30); a propeller rotor (5) beared by the bearing structure (30), wherein the propeller rotor (5) includes multiple blades (51) and, upstream of the blades (51), a nose cone (50) which are attached to rotate with the propeller rotor (5), at least one electromotor (2) configured for driving the propeller rotor (5); and an air-cooling system (7) for at least one subsystem of the propeller engine (1) including at least one inlet opening (70) for receiving an intake stream of cooling air through the propeller rotor (5), wherein the air-cooling system (7) includes least one vortex chamber (71, 71a, 71b, 71c, 71d, 71e) connected to the propeller rotor (5), wherein the vortex chamber (71, 71a, 71b, 71c, 71d, 71e) is configured to receive the cooling air from the inlet opening (70) before the cooling air is provided to the at least one subsystem and/or wherein the at least one subsystem includes an electromotor subsystem (20) including a fluid barrier (21) separating a closed cooling circuit (8) containing electromotor electronics, in particular control electronics (21) and/or electromagnets, from the cooling air of the air-cooling system (7).
